Overview: Train from Roby to Stockport
Typically, there are 4 trains per day from Roby to Stockport, including direct trains, taking around 1h 20m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£17 if you book in advance.
The earliest train runs at 09:54, the last at 21:36. The fastest train covers the 46 km distance in 1h 42m.

Accessibility
Accessibility facilities are available at Stockport: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: This station has step-free access to all platforms / the platform Lifts are available to all platforms via the station subway,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es.
